Gok Wan searches for Naked Beauty

British Beauties Bare all for Chance at ‘Miss Naked Beauty’ Title

Last night, I caught the first episode of the ‘Miss Naked Beauty’ pageant. The programme which aired on C4 was hosted by every woman’s favourite stylist Gok Wan and model/presenter Myleena Klass.

C4 describes the show as being ‘the definitive hunt for a woman who embodies the confidence, sex appeal, spirit, brains and true natural beauty of a modern-day Eve.’

2008 MOBO Awards Show – Best of Beauty

The 13th Annual MOBO (Music of Black Origin) Awards ceremony was held last night at London’s Wembley Arena.

The event, which was hosted by Spice Girl/Ultimo Lingerie spokesmodel, Mel B (aka Scary Spice) and Run DMC founder Rev Run showcased some of the UK’s most talented artists.
